Can we stop with the false narrative that Miles "parlayed Saban's cupboard" into his success.

Miles was the coach at LSU for 12 years. During that time he had 114 wins.

It was time at the end for Les to leave. But its not fair to diminish all his accomplishments by giving credit to Saban when Miles had multiple double digit win seasons long after Saban left.




WHoleheartedly agree.

Even the year we won it in 2007, there was only one class left on the roster that was recruited by Saban. Miles was a great coach........................probably the greatest in LSU history. But at the end his time had run out.
